Understanding Heat Exchange Technology
Heat exchange espresso machines operate on an unique principle that enables simultaneous water heating for brewing and steaming. They are equipped with a single boiler that utilizes a heat exchanger system. This feature is significant as it allows users to brew espresso while steaming milk concurrently, promoting efficiency in the coffee-making procedure.
How Does a Heat Exchange Espresso Machine Work?
The procedure starts with the machine's water inlet filling the boiler. As the water warms up, it turns to steam. The ingenious heat exchanger uses hot steam to heat additional water in a separate passage designed particularly for the brew group. This indicates that water can reach the perfect brewing temperature without waiting for the boiler to change. The crucial actions include:
- Water Fill: Water is drawn into the boiler.
- Heating Process: The boiler warms up as water is converted into steam.
- Heat Exchange: Steam heats up water in the heat exchanger tube.
- Developing: Water from the heat exchanger is pushed through coffee grounds, drawing out the tastes required for an abundant espresso.
This process enables quick temperature level modifications and improved coffee extraction.

Secret Features to Look for in Heat Exchange Espresso Machines
When considering the purchase of a heat exchange espresso machine, there are numerous functions that one must consider:
- Build Quality: Look for machines made from long lasting materials, such as stainless steel or brass, guaranteeing longevity.
- Boiler Size: A larger boiler will hold more water and sustain greater output over time.
- PID Temperature Control: This feature helps keep constant brew temperatures, which can boost the coffee-making process.
- Group Head Design: Machines with a saturated or semi-saturated group head provide much better temperature stability.
- Alleviate of Use: User-friendly user interfaces and instinctive controls improve the total experience for baristas at all skill levels.
- Steam Wand Quality: A great steam wand with appropriate insulation and versatility permits for better texturing of milk.
- Water Reservoir Size: Depending on your needs, think about how often you wish to fill up the water tank.

Frequently Asked Questions About Heat Exchange Espresso Machines
What is the primary distinction between a heat exchange and a dual boiler espresso machine?
While both types can brew espresso and steam milk at the very same time, dual boiler machines have different boilers for brewing and steaming. On Sleek Espresso Machines , heat exchange machines utilize a single boiler and a heat exchanger to attain the very same function.
Are heat exchange machines ideal for novices?
Yes! Many heat exchange machines are designed with user-friendly functions, making them available for beginners. With proper assistance and practice, users can quickly produce quality espresso.
What type of maintenance do heat exchange espresso machines require?
Routine maintenance includes descaling, cleaning the boiler, checking seals and gaskets, and keeping the group head clean. Routine maintenance ensures longevity and consistent performance.
